Job description

Job Level & compensation offered may vary depending on candidates’ experiences and competencies .

Responsibilities
  • Determine the acceptability of samples with guidelines and prepare specimens for analysis.
  • Validate the accuracy of laboratory data.
  • Evaluate the test results accurately in accordance with procedures.
  • Operate instruments to perform testing in accordance with established written procedures.
  • Perform experiments, as scheduled, for evaluation of new reagents. Maintain quality control of laboratory testing to ensure accurate and timely lab reporting. Document corrective and preventative actions with good documentation practices.
  • Assist in the servicing and maintenance of laboratory equipment according to manufacturer and SOP requirements.
  • Comply with regulatory guidelines and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) at all times.
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in a biomedical or biological science from an accredited college or university.
  • Fresh graduates with relevant internship experience are welcome to apply.
  • Minimum 2 years of working experience in a clinical laboratory will be preferred.
  • Good analytical skills with attention to details.
  • Able to work independently as well as a good team player with initiative and adaptive to changes.
  • Good planning and organizing skills.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ills.
